The spumante Cruasé Pinot Nero Rosé Brut Metodo Classico Oltrepò Pavese DOCG from the winery Tenuta Mazzolino has been rated in 2020 by Othmar Kiem und Simon Staffler with 93 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Pinot Noir from the region Lombardia in Italy.
Tasting Notes
Bright, shining rose colour. Complex on the nose, hearty and multi-layered, red berry, raspberry, wild berry, a hint of orange zest, then wet stone, also some grapefruit, with slightly cold smoke in the background. Balanced and vivid on the palate, it spreads elegantly, delicate fruit texture, wonderfully integrated mousse, it is balanced and harmonious all the way to the finish.
